Превращенный там переменная среды под названием ENABLE_D_LOG=0|1, который равняется 1 по умолчанию и который ответственен за регистрирующееся безумие. Установка его к 0 закрывает драйвер. Таким образом, я создал сценарий обертки для demond, который устанавливает ENABLE_D_LOG=0 и затем называет исходный demond:
# cd /usr/local/lexmark/legacy/bin
# mv demond demond.orig
# cat > demond <<EOF
#!/bin/sh
export ENABLE_D_LOG=0
/usr/local/lexmark/legacy/bin/demond.orig $@
EOF
# chmod +x demond
cd /home/sub1/samples
for file in aaa*/*_novoalign.bam; do
target_file="${file%_novoalign.bam}_output.txt"
samtools depth -r chr9:218026635-21994999 <"$file" >"$target_file"
done
-121--244372- на Mac OS 10.10.2, посмотрите на файл /etc/locate.rc
для поля Prunepaths
. Из страницы человека Apple для locate.uppdatedb :
:
:
Описание
Обновляет утилиту
. Обновление Утилиты
База данных, используемой, находит (1)
. Обычно бежит один раз в неделю/system/library/launchdaemons/com.apple.locate.plist
. Содержимое Из недавно встроенной базы данных можно контролировать/etc/locate.rc
файл.Коррекция : Вышеуказанная ссылка и цитируемый контент предназначен для Mac OS 10.9. Настройка оказывается такой же в ОС 10.10.2.
Ваша ~ / библиотека, ~ / документы, ~ / приложения ... etc все создаются с 700 в качестве разрешения. Найти их пропустить. Если вы хотите, чтобы они были включены в вашу базу данных, измените разрешение на 755.
chmod 755 ~/Library
sudo /usr/libexec/locate.updatedb